SLD failed to start

Former Member
0 Kudos

Hello all,

when launching our SLD '<server>:<port>/webdynpro/dispatcher/sap.com/tcsldwd~main/Main'

the following error occurred:

500 Internal Server Error

SAP J2EE Engine/7.00

Application error occurred during request processing.

Details:

com.sap.tc.webdynpro.services.sal.core.DispatcherException: Failed to start deployable object sap.com/tcsldwd~main.

Exception id: [001B789342BE006F00049723000013F100045684A0FE2FBD]

-


In Web Dynpro Content Administrator I can see this:

No resource bundles found for development component ''sap.com/tcsldwd~admin''.

Failed to start development component ''sap.com/tcsldwd~main'' on the server. Development component not deployed correctly.

Hi Sebastian,

Start the Visual Administrator of the J2EE engine.

1. Choose Cluster u2192 Server u2192 Services u2192 Deploy

2. In the right frame, select the radio button Application.

A list of the deployed services appears.

3. Check if the following services are running

If the services you mentioned are not running, select the services and choose Start Application.
